Class JSDocInfoPrinter

java.lang.Object
com.google.javascript.jscomp.JSDocInfoPrinter

public final class JSDocInfoPrinter extends Object
Prints a JSDocInfo, used for preserving type annotations in ES6 transpilation.
  • Constructor Details

    • JSDocInfoPrinter

      public JSDocInfoPrinter(boolean useOriginalName)
    • JSDocInfoPrinter

      public JSDocInfoPrinter(boolean useOriginalName, boolean printDesc)
      Parameters:
      useOriginalName - Whether to use the original name field when printing types.
      printDesc - Whether to print block, param, and return descriptions.
  • Method Details